H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T HYDERABAD FOR THE STATE OF TELANGANA AND THE STATE OF ANDHRA PRADESH PRESENT THE HON'BLE THE ACTING CHIEF JUSTICE DILIP B. BHOSALE AND THE HON'BLE SRI JUSTICE P.NAVEEN RAO WRIT APPEAL No.536 of 2016 DATED: 12.07.2016 Between:

Mohammed Afzal Biyabani Rasviul Quadri ... Appellant and The State of Telangana and others ... Respondents

THE HON'BLE THE ACTING CHIEF JUSTICE DILIP B. BHOSALE AND THE HON'BLE SRI JUSTICE P. NAVEEN RAO WRIT APPEAL No.536 OF 2016 PC: (per the Hon'ble The Acting Chief Justice Dilip B. Bhosale) Mr. Md. Ajmal Ahmed, learned counsel for appellant submits that with the passage of time, Writ Appeal has rendered infructuous.

Writ Appeal is dismissed as infructuous. However, dismissal of Writ Appeal shall not preclude the appellant from challenging the election in appropriate proceedings. Consequently, miscellaneous petitions, if any, also stand disposed of.
